Zip Code 22312 Population

Population breakdown by gender

Population in zip code 22312 is 29,133 residents | Male to Female ratio is 1:1.04 | Zip Code 22312 land area is 5.3572 sq. miles | Population density is 5,438.10 residents per square mile

Median age in zip code 22312

  Median Age
Zip Code Median Age 34.5
Median Age - Male 34.6
Median Age - Female 34.4

Median age of zip code 22312 is 6.8% lower compared to nearby zip codes and 7.3% lower compared to the United States median age. Comparing gender-specific madian age yields the following results. Male median age of zip code 22312 is 3.9% lower compared to nearby zip codes and 3.4% lower compared to the United States male median age. Female zip code 22312 median age is 9.5% lower in comparison to nearby zip codes and 10.6% lower compared to female national median age average.

Real Estate in zip code 22312

Housing occupied 91.44%
Housing vacant 8.56%
Housing occupied by owner 49.73%
Housing occupied by tenant 50.27%
Total Rented Units 5358
Median Contract Gross Rent $1,377
Median Gross Rent $1,456
Median Home Value $414,100

Contract rent is the monthly cash rent agreed to, regardless of any furnishings, utilities, fees, meals, or services that may be included. Gross rent is the contract rent plus the estimated average monthly cost of utilities and fuels if these are paid by the renter. In zip code 22312 median gross rent is 5.74% larger then the median contract rent.
